First-Year Nonresident WUE Scholarship

The Western Undergraduate Exchange (WUE) is a program for undergraduate students that allows nonresident students to pay 150% of resident tuition. The program is filled on a yearly basis beginning with fall semester, and is set for a maximum of 8 semesters. Students receiving the WUE will 不 receive a 'scholarship' or 'waiver', instead their residency code will be changed and the student will be charged a WUE tuition rate (at 150% of resident tuition).

Students must be a legal resident of a participating state: Alaska, Arizona, California, Colorado, Commonwealth of the Northern Mariana Islands (CNMI), Guam, Hawaii, Idaho, Montana, Nevada, New Mexico, North Dakota, Oregon, Republic of Marshall Islands, South Dakota, Washington, and Wyoming. Time the student is enrolled on the WUE will NOT count towards requirements for resident status for tuition purposes.

After receiving an invitation to participate in the WUE program at USU, a student must do the following to remain eligible:

  • Be enrolled, can不 exceed a total of 8 semesters of eligibility.
  • Maintain a GPA to remain in good standing at USU.
  • Have 不 accepted any other USU scholarship in the form of tuition waiver or tuition reduction (private cash awards or scholarships are acceptable).
  • Pursue a first undergraduate degree (students pursuing a second bachelors degree are 不 eligible).
  • WUE is available to students attending Logan, Statewide and Southeast Campuses (USU Eastern, Blanding, 摩押). Out-of-state online students are 不 eligible.

Students accepting the WUE are 不 eligible to establish Utah Residency for tuition purposes.

HB144 Utah Nonresident Tuition Exception Affidavit

Any student other than a nonimmigrant alien who meets all the following requirements, shall be exempt from paying the nonresident portion of the total tuition at Utah State University. Student information provided in this affidavit is strictly confidential unless disclosure is required by law.

Requirements
  • The student must have attended a Utah high school for three or more years.
  • The student must have graduated from a Utah high school or attained the equivalent of a high school diploma (GED) in Utah.
  • Students must submit their official high school transcript(s) validating three-year high school attendance in Utah and graduation from a Utah high school.
  • A student, who is without lawful immigration status, must file an affidavit with Utah State University stating that he or she has filed an application to legalize immigration status, or will file an application as soon as he or she is eligible to do so.
  • Students who hold a nonimmigrant alien visa are 不 eligible for this exemption.
  • Students eligible for this exemption who are transferring to a不her Utah public college or university must submit a new request (and documentation if required) to each college under consideration.
  • Students meeting the criteria will have the nonresident portion of their tuition waived, but continue to be classified as nonresidents.
  • Students who qualify for this exemption are 不 eligible for state and federal financial aid.
Procedures for Requesting the Exemption
  1. Fill out the application.
  2. In addition to any credentials necessary for admission to Utah State University, you must arrange to have your final Utah high school transcript verifying graduation sent directly to the Utah State University Admissions Office. The transcript must show completion of at least three years in a Utah high school and proof that you have graduated from the Utah high school or have an equivalency of a high school diploma in Utah.
Before You Apply

Once you are determined to be eligible for the exemption, you will continue to receive it as long as you fulfill the requirements listed below and in your acceptance agreement letter, or Utah State University no longer offers this exemption. Applying for the exemption does 不 in any way alter your responsibility to pay on time any nonresident tuition and associated fees that may be due before your eligibility is determined. This exemption of nonresident tuition will 不 be considered until you are an admitted student to Utah State University. ALL requirements of R512.4.5 must be met.

Grants

Grants are forms of aid you do 不 have to repay. Applicants may receive grants based on financial aid. Grants are available through the federal and state governments. Keep in mind:

  1. Repayment is 不 required.
  2. Funding levels may vary from year to year according to legislative appropriation.
  3. To meet tuition deadlines, file the FAFSA by the end of June.
 

Loans

Federal loans allow students or their families to borrow money at low interest rates. Keep in mind:

  1. Repayment plus interest is required.
  2. To meet tuition deadlines, file the FAFSA by the end of June.
 

Federal Work Study

The Federal Work-Study program provides funds for jobs for eligible students to help them pay for their education. Keep in mind:

  1. Students are offered the dollar amount that they can work to earn over the course of the academic year.
  2. Student Financial 援助 refers students to jobs on or off campus.
  3. To be considered, answer “yes” to the work-study question and submit the FAFSA before the end of March.
